Firstly, it’s important to understand that there is no one-size-fits-all answer to the question of ideal weight. Each person’s body is unique, and what may be considered ideal for one individual may not be the same for another. Factors such as genetics, age, height, and muscle mass all play a role in determining the ideal weight for an individual.
One common method for estimating ideal weight is by using the Body Mass Index (BMI), which is calculated by dividing a person’s weight in kilograms by the square of their height in meters. While BMI can provide a general guideline, it’s important to note that it does not take into account muscle mass or body composition. Therefore, it may not be entirely accurate for individuals who are very muscular or have a higher percentage of muscle mass.
